"Mathematicians Playing Games explores a wide variety of popular mathematical games, including their historical beginnings and the mathematical theories that underpin them. Its academic level is suitable for high school students and higher, but people of any age or level will find something to entertain them, and something new to learn. It would be a fantastic resource for high school mathematics classrooms or undergraduate mathematics for liberal arts course, and belongs on the shelf of anyone with an interest in recreational mathematics.
